  19. #include <drm/drm_crtc.h>
  20. #include <drm/drm_fb_helper.h>
  21. #include "omap_drv.h"
  22. MODULE_PARM_DESC(ywrap, "Enable ywrap scrolling (omap44xx and later, default 'y')");
  23. static bool ywrap_enabled = true;
  24. module_param_named(ywrap, ywrap_enabled, bool, 0644);
  25. /*
  26. * fbdev funcs, to implement legacy fbdev interface on top of drm driver
  27. */
  28. #define to_omap_fbdev(x) container_of(x, struct omap_fbdev, base)
  29. struct omap_fbdev {
  30. struct drm_fb_helper base;
  31. struct drm_framebuffer *fb;
  32. struct drm_gem_object *bo;
  33. bool ywrap_enabled;
  34. /* for deferred dmm roll when getting called in atomic ctx */
  35. struct work_struct work;
  36. };
  37. static struct drm_fb_helper *get_fb(struct fb_info *fbi);
  38. static void pan_worker(struct work_struct *work)
  39. {
  40. struct omap_fbdev *fbdev = container_of(work, struct omap_fbdev, work);
  41. struct fb_info *fbi = fbdev->base.fbdev;
  42. int npages;
  43. /* DMM roll shifts in 4K pages: */
  44. npages = fbi->fix.line_length >> PAGE_SHIFT;
  45. omap_gem_roll(fbdev->bo, fbi->var.yoffset * npages);
  46. }
  47. static int omap_fbdev_pan_display(struct fb_var_screeninfo *var,
  48. struct fb_info *fbi)
  49. {
  50. struct drm_fb_helper *helper = get_fb(fbi);
  51. struct omap_fbdev *fbdev = to_omap_fbdev(helper);
  52. if (!helper)
  53. goto fallback;
  54. if (!fbdev->ywrap_enabled)
  55. goto fallback;
  56. if (drm_can_sleep()) {
  57. pan_worker(&fbdev->work);
  58. } else {
  59. struct omap_drm_private *priv = helper->dev->dev_private;
  60. queue_work(priv->wq, &fbdev->work);
  61. }
  62. return 0;
  63. fallback:
  64. return drm_fb_helper_pan_display(var, fbi);
  65. }
  66. static struct fb_ops omap_fb_ops = {
  67. .owner = THIS_MODULE,
  68. DRM_FB_HELPER_DEFAULT_OPS,
  69. /* Note: to properly handle manual update displays, we wrap the
  70. * basic fbdev ops which write to the framebuffer
  71. */
  72. .fb_read = drm_fb_helper_sys_read,
  73. .fb_write = drm_fb_helper_sys_write,
  74. .fb_fillrect = drm_fb_helper_sys_fillrect,
  75. .fb_copyarea = drm_fb_helper_sys_copyarea,
  76. .fb_imageblit = drm_fb_helper_sys_imageblit,
  77. .fb_pan_display = omap_fbdev_pan_display,
  78. };
  79. static int omap_fbdev_create(struct drm_fb_helper *helper,
  80. struct drm_fb_helper_surface_size *sizes)
  81. {
  82. struct omap_fbdev *fbdev = to_omap_fbdev(helper);
  83. struct drm_device *dev = helper->dev;
  84. struct omap_drm_private *priv = dev->dev_private;
  85. struct drm_framebuffer *fb = NULL;
  86. union omap_gem_size gsize;
  87. struct fb_info *fbi = NULL;
  88. struct drm_mode_fb_cmd2 mode_cmd = {0};
  89. dma_addr_t dma_addr;
  90. int ret;
  91. sizes->surface_bpp = 32;
  92. sizes->surface_depth = 24;
  93. DBG("create fbdev: %dx%d@%d (%dx%d)", sizes->surface_width,
  94. sizes->surface_height, sizes->surface_bpp,
  95. sizes->fb_width, sizes->fb_height);
  96. mode_cmd.pixel_format = drm_mode_legacy_fb_format(sizes->surface_bpp,
  97. sizes->surface_depth);
  98. mode_cmd.width = sizes->surface_width;
  99. mode_cmd.height = sizes->surface_height;
  100. mode_cmd.pitches[0] =
  101. DIV_ROUND_UP(mode_cmd.width * sizes->surface_bpp, 8);
  102. fbdev->ywrap_enabled = priv->has_dmm && ywrap_enabled;
  103. if (fbdev->ywrap_enabled) {
  104. /* need to align pitch to page size if using DMM scrolling */
  105. mode_cmd.pitches[0] = PAGE_ALIGN(mode_cmd.pitches[0]);
  106. }
  107. /* allocate backing bo */
  108. gsize = (union omap_gem_size){
  109. .bytes = PAGE_ALIGN(mode_cmd.pitches[0] * mode_cmd.height),
  110. };
  111. DBG("allocating %d bytes for fb %d", gsize.bytes, dev->primary->index);
  112. fbdev->bo = omap_gem_new(dev, gsize, OMAP_BO_SCANOUT | OMAP_BO_WC);
  113. if (!fbdev->bo) {
  114. dev_err(dev->dev, "failed to allocate buffer object\n");
  115. ret = -ENOMEM;
  116. goto fail;
  117. }
  118. fb = omap_framebuffer_init(dev, &mode_cmd, &fbdev->bo);
  119. if (IS_ERR(fb)) {
  120. dev_err(dev->dev, "failed to allocate fb\n");
  121. /* note: if fb creation failed, we can't rely on fb destroy
  122. * to unref the bo:
  123. */
  124. drm_gem_object_unreference_unlocked(fbdev->bo);
  125. ret = PTR_ERR(fb);
  126. goto fail;
  127. }
  128. /* note: this keeps the bo pinned.. which is perhaps not ideal,
  129. * but is needed as long as we use fb_mmap() to mmap to userspace
  130. * (since this happens using fix.smem_start). Possibly we could
  131. * implement our own mmap using GEM mmap support to avoid this
  132. * (non-tiled buffer doesn't need to be pinned for fbcon to write
  133. * to it). Then we just need to be sure that we are able to re-
  134. * pin it in case of an opps.
  135. */
  136. ret = omap_gem_get_paddr(fbdev->bo, &dma_addr);
  137. if (ret) {
  138. dev_err(dev->dev,
  139. "could not map (paddr)! Skipping framebuffer alloc\n");
  140. ret = -ENOMEM;
  141. goto fail;
  142. }
  143. mutex_lock(&dev->struct_mutex);
  144. fbi = drm_fb_helper_alloc_fbi(helper);
  145. if (IS_ERR(fbi)) {
  146. dev_err(dev->dev, "failed to allocate fb info\n");
  147. ret = PTR_ERR(fbi);
  148. goto fail_unlock;
  149. }
  150. DBG("fbi=%p, dev=%p", fbi, dev);
  151. fbdev->fb = fb;
  152. helper->fb = fb;
  153. fbi->par = helper;
  154. fbi->flags = FBINFO_DEFAULT;
  155. fbi->fbops = &omap_fb_ops;
  156. strcpy(fbi->fix.id, MODULE_NAME);
  157. drm_fb_helper_fill_fix(fbi, fb->pitches[0], fb->format->depth);
  158. drm_fb_helper_fill_var(fbi, helper, sizes->fb_width, sizes->fb_height);
  159. dev->mode_config.fb_base = dma_addr;
  160. fbi->screen_base = omap_gem_vaddr(fbdev->bo);
  161. fbi->screen_size = fbdev->bo->size;
  162. fbi->fix.smem_start = dma_addr;
  163. fbi->fix.smem_len = fbdev->bo->size;
  164. /* if we have DMM, then we can use it for scrolling by just
  165. * shuffling pages around in DMM rather than doing sw blit.
  166. */
  167. if (fbdev->ywrap_enabled) {
  168. DRM_INFO("Enabling DMM ywrap scrolling\n");
  169. fbi->flags |= FBINFO_HWACCEL_YWRAP | FBINFO_READS_FAST;
  170. fbi->fix.ywrapstep = 1;
  171. }
  172. DBG("par=%p, %dx%d", fbi->par, fbi->var.xres, fbi->var.yres);
  173. DBG("allocated %dx%d fb", fbdev->fb->width, fbdev->fb->height);
  174. mutex_unlock(&dev->struct_mutex);
  175. return 0;
  176. fail_unlock:
  177. mutex_unlock(&dev->struct_mutex);
  178. fail:
  179. if (ret) {
  180. if (fb)
  181. drm_framebuffer_remove(fb);
  182. }
  183. return ret;
  184. }
  185. static const struct drm_fb_helper_funcs omap_fb_helper_funcs = {
  186. .fb_probe = omap_fbdev_create,
  187. };
  188. static struct drm_fb_helper *get_fb(struct fb_info *fbi)
  189. {
  190. if (!fbi || strcmp(fbi->fix.id, MODULE_NAME)) {
  191. /* these are not the fb's you're looking for */
  192. return NULL;
  193. }
  194. return fbi->par;
  195. }
  196. /* initialize fbdev helper */
  197. struct drm_fb_helper *omap_fbdev_init(struct drm_device *dev)
  198. {
  199. struct omap_drm_private *priv = dev->dev_private;
  200. struct omap_fbdev *fbdev = NULL;
  201. struct drm_fb_helper *helper;
  202. int ret = 0;
  203. fbdev = kzalloc(sizeof(*fbdev), GFP_KERNEL);
  204. if (!fbdev)
  205. goto fail;
  206. INIT_WORK(&fbdev->work, pan_worker);
  207. helper = &fbdev->base;
  208. drm_fb_helper_prepare(dev, helper, &omap_fb_helper_funcs);
  209. ret = drm_fb_helper_init(dev, helper, priv->num_connectors);
  210. if (ret) {
  211. dev_err(dev->dev, "could not init fbdev: ret=%d\n", ret);
  212. goto fail;
  213. }
  214. ret = drm_fb_helper_single_add_all_connectors(helper);
  215. if (ret)
  216. goto fini;
  217. ret = drm_fb_helper_initial_config(helper, 32);
  218. if (ret)
  219. goto fini;
  220. priv->fbdev = helper;
  221. return helper;
  222. fini:
  223. drm_fb_helper_fini(helper);
  224. fail:
  225. kfree(fbdev);
  226. dev_warn(dev->dev, "omap_fbdev_init failed\n");
  227. /* well, limp along without an fbdev.. maybe X11 will work? */
  228. return NULL;
  229. }
  230. void omap_fbdev_free(struct drm_device *dev)
  231. {
  232. struct omap_drm_private *priv = dev->dev_private;
  233. struct drm_fb_helper *helper = priv->fbdev;
  234. struct omap_fbdev *fbdev;
  235. DBG();
  236. drm_fb_helper_unregister_fbi(helper);
  237. drm_fb_helper_fini(helper);
  238. fbdev = to_omap_fbdev(priv->fbdev);
  239. /* release the ref taken in omap_fbdev_create() */
  240. omap_gem_put_paddr(fbdev->bo);
  241. /* this will free the backing object */
  242. if (fbdev->fb)
  243. drm_framebuffer_remove(fbdev->fb);
  244. kfree(fbdev);
  245. priv->fbdev = NULL;
  246. }
